Most small business owners know they need video. What they're not sure about is which type to start with. It's a fair question — there are dozens of video formats out there, and the wrong choice means spending real money on something that doesn't move the needle.
I've been producing video for local businesses in Hagerstown and across Washington County for 8 years. Here are the five types that consistently deliver the most value for small businesses in this market.
Nothing sells like a real customer talking about real results. A professionally produced testimonial video — with proper lighting, clean audio, and thoughtful editing — is the single highest-converting piece of video content most small businesses can own. When a potential customer is comparing you to a competitor, watching someone exactly like them describe why they chose you is more persuasive than any marketing copy you can write.
- Builds immediate trust and social proof
- Works across your website, Google Business Profile, and social media
- Has a long shelf life — a well-produced testimonial stays relevant for years
- Ideal for service businesses: contractors, medical practices, restaurants, consultants
Best for: Any service-based business. Start here if you have satisfied clients and a decision-making sales cycle longer than 24 hours.

If your business offers something that takes more than two sentences to explain, an explainer video pays for itself. These videos walk potential customers through what you offer, how it works, and what they can expect — which means your sales conversations start at a higher level of understanding. For businesses in Hagerstown with services that are unfamiliar or complex, this type of video dramatically improves lead quality.
- Educates leads before they reach your sales team or contact form
- Reduces repetitive questions and shortens the sales cycle
- Can include on-camera demos, voiceover, or animated graphics depending on the service
- Works well embedded in email sequences, landing pages, and ad campaigns
Best for: Healthcare providers, home services contractors, financial advisors, legal professionals, and any business with a multi-step service offering.
Social media video doesn't need to be your most polished work — but it still needs to look intentional. A package of 4–6 short-form videos shot in a single session gives you months of consistent content that keeps your business visible between bigger campaigns. For Hagerstown businesses competing for local attention on Facebook, Instagram, and YouTube, consistency matters more than perfection.
- Keeps your brand visible to the local audience year-round
- Cost-effective when shot in batch during a single production session
- Can be repurposed from longer brand or testimonial footage
- Feeds paid social campaigns with native-looking creative
Best for: Retail shops, restaurants, gyms, event venues, and businesses that rely on repeat local foot traffic or community visibility.
If your business hosts events — grand openings, anniversary celebrations, community sponsorships, trade shows, or annual gatherings — a professionally edited highlight reel turns that moment into a permanent marketing asset. The footage you capture at a well-attended local event can be used in your next campaign, on your website, and in pitch decks for months after the event is over.
- Preserves community moments in a format you can share indefinitely
- Demonstrates social proof through crowd size and community involvement
- Creates urgency and FOMO for future events
- Perfect for nonprofits, hospitality businesses, and civic organizations
Best for: Any business that hosts or sponsors events as part of their community engagement and marketing strategy.
HOW TO PRIORITIZE
If you're not sure where to start, here's a simple framework:
| If you need to... | Start with... | Timeline to ROI |
|---|---|---|
| Build trust with new visitors | Client Testimonial Video | Immediate |
| Communicate who you are | Brand Overview Video | 30–90 days |
| Shorten your sales cycle | Service Explainer Video | 60–120 days |
| Stay visible on social media | Short-Form Content Package | Ongoing |
| Leverage a community moment | Event Highlight Reel | Immediate to 90 days |
